Skip to content
This repository has been archived by the owner on Feb 19, 2023. It is now read-only.

Puppeteer enabled Docker image!

License

Notifications You must be signed in to change notification settings

zrosenbauer/docker-puppeteer

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

docker-puppeteer

Docker container with Chromium, node.js, and puppeteer.

NOTE: Check the Dockerfile to see the current node version.

Usage

docker pull bluenovaio/docker-puppeteer:v1.0.0

Example Use

This can be used to run puppeteer in Docker, usually used when snapshotting create-react-app applications.

FROM bluenova/docker-puppeteer:v1.0.0

RUN yarn
RUN yarn build

# Run a snapshoot tool i.e. react-snap
RUN yarn snapshot

# Expose port and run server
EXPOSE 8080
CMD [ "node", "./server.js" ]